Chapter 179 Unexpected Encounter
Sean lay down and fell asleep in no time.
Analise brought out a blanket from the house and covered him with it. He looked at the worry in his eyes, and she sighed softly.
She had no idea what had happened between the two of them.
After she returned to the kitchen, she scooped up the dumplings and called Abigail on WhatsApp.
Soon, the call was connected.
Analise looked at Abigail with a face full of affection and asked, “How’s work been lately?”
She Had a feeling that this call was related to Sean.
Abigail bit her lip and asked Analise. “It’s been okay. What’s going on?”
“You haven’t come back for a long time, and I miss you. During the New Year, from the first day to the third day, it was Sean who was afraid I’d be lonely, so he came to keep me company,” Analise said with a gentle voice.
She sat in the kitchen and glanced at Sean, who was resting in the corridor.
Analise was still anxious about Sean.
Maybe he hadn’t been feeling comfortable at home, so he had come to her for some comfort and food.
When Abigail heard what Analise said, she was a bit surprised. After a moment of silence, she asked in a soft voice, “He spent three days with you during the New Year?”
“Yes,” Analise replied with a smile.
Abigail felt a bit complicated after hearing Analise’s words. She chatted with Analise for a while. before hanging up as she was busy.
